True/False: Static routing requires more processing and extra computing resources than dynamic routing protocols.

Solution

False. Static routing does not require more processing and extra computing resources than dynamic routing protocols. In fact, it's the opposite. Dynamic routing protocols require more processing power and memory because they constantly analyze network traffic patterns and adjust their own routing tables accordingly. Static routes, on the other hand, are manually set up by a network administrator and do not change unless the administrator changes them. Therefore, they require less processing power and memory.
